Once there was a poor lady who lived on
斯
a hill near the seashore.Her husband died.
She had no children and lived by herself.She
was so poor that she had to work hard every
day.
h
北
But one night as she sat at the table,the
lady said to herself,"I wish I could be of
some use to the world.Why can't I do good
痴
to someone else besides myself?"At last,she
came up with an idea.
She decided that she would keep a ligh-
ted lamp at the window for the sailors every
night.She found that ships sometimes hit the
戡
rocks in the sea,since there was no light-
house to warn them of the danger at night.
Maybe her lamp would warn them when their
ships came near the rocks on the coast.
The lady felt glad when the thought
came into her mind.She found that,if she
worked an hour longer each night,she could
警
make enough money to pay for the oil for the
lamp.So she worked late and made money to
buy the oil and then she placed the lamp at
the window each night.In this way she saved
many lives.
She did this for five years without any
reward,or the hope of reward.However,
good deeds are often found out.The sailors
whose lives had been saved began to send
业水平合格考(七)
为90分钟。)
gifts to her from faraway countries.They
sent her tea from China,cloth from India,
silk from France and grapes from Spain.But
the poor lady did not need these gifts to make
her happy.She gave many of them to the
poor and the sick.
She was happy with the thought that she
was doing something good.So,as long as
she lived,she would light her lamp each
night and place it at the window.

Gardening can be a very relaxing hobby
for many people and this wonderful experi-
ence is not just for adults.Children are inter-
ested in gardening as well,if given the chance
to explore nature and science in this way.
Gardening can bring joy to both children and
their parents alike,especially when the expe-
rience is shared together.
The time that is spent gardening togeth-
er builds precious memories within their
hearts and minds for years to come.When
you are gardening with your children,try to
give them their own special area.Keep their
area in the center of the best soil and light,as
you want to make sure of a successful gar-
dening experience.
Plastic tools break easily and are difficult
to use in the dirt,so when you are gardening
with your children,give them real tools to use
if possible.Even offering to let them use your
tools is a way to admit the worth of the work
they are doing.It is also important to talk
with your children about the whole process of
gardening,from planting to the harvest.They
need to understand how things work and the
importance of what they are doing.
Show off the children's gardening work
by taking friends and visitors for a walking
tour through the garden and point out the
children's particular spot.When you give at-
tention to the children's work,this is a great
motivation for children to continue wanting to
be involved.Do not force children to take part
when they are in a bad mood or if they are be-
coming bored.Instead,allow them to do
7-2
something different,like building a scarecrow
(稻草人)!This will make the gardening ex
perience even more interesting.As you work
together side by side with your children,you
will encourage a love of the land in them,as
well as create lasting memories of the time
spent with you.
